This is the original source: (Famitsu "Connect On!" magazine, to be published on 9/27)
The big title is "FFXIV, first anniversary and beyond", this cover is illustrated by art director Yoshida Akehiko, and the cover story will be the interview of our Yoshi-P.
Obviously the characters are one-to-one correspond to current 7 classes, but their gears are derived from the "Job artifacts" (AF) of FFXI, especially PLD, WHM, BLM, and MNK.
(Edit: I must emphasize, the original design of these gears can trace back to FFI ~ FFIII, but its the FFXI that first use them as "identity of jobs")
The DRG can be identified from its headgear, which is the trademark of most famous DRG of FF series, Cain (FFIV).
But the RNG is very confusing, because the hat is somewhat like RDM and there is a harp on her bow.
After all, the Job system supposed to be go live on v1.21 is still far away, and maybe we will get more information from the interview inside. I MUST pre-order one today...
